???
Математика на уровне МГУ

Страница 55 из 112 ПерваяПервая ... 54551525354555657585965105 ... КрайняяКрайняя
Показано с 1,351 по 1,375 из 2776

Тема: USB контроллер джойстика

  1. #1351
    Зашедший Аватар для ironman
    Регистрация
    03.06.2005
    Адрес
    Господин Великий Новгород
    Возраст
    60
    Сообщений
    434

    Re: USB контроллер джоистика

    Цитата Сообщение от fred kaa Посмотреть сообщение
    По идее не должно сгореть(если сгорит, у меня есть ещё два контроллера)), то есть я говорил о примерных напряжениях, с более точными цифрами получается такая картинка:
    На Mjopy16 и датчиках ss495A у меня выходит такая картина, не дотягивает отклик до конечных значений буквально по 4 единицы градаций контроллера.
    5 вольт делим на 1024, получаем 0,0048828125вольта на градацию, умножаем на 4, получаем 0,01953125. То есть, по моим рассуждениям нужно подать на холл 5,02 вольта для получения полного отклика, при этом на вход контроллера доберётся положенные 5 вольт(почему должен сгореть АЦП? ).
    ...отклика и так хватает, но хочется достичь идеала )) ...знаний только у меня не хватает (
    Фред ! Лучшее - враг хорошего!Это уже попахивает паранойей.
    Ты лучше просвети , в частности меня , почему калибровка временами уходит.Блок питания ?

  2. #1352

    Re: USB контроллер джоистика

    В Datashee для SS495A максимальное выходное напряжение Uвых.max=U-0.4 В. Надо повышать до 5.4 вольт.
    Вложения Вложения

  3. #1353
    Курсант
    Регистрация
    06.02.2005
    Адрес
    Северодвинск
    Возраст
    58
    Сообщений
    426

    Re: USB контроллер джоистика

    На паранойю не согласен )) просто интересно что получится, и получится ли вообще.

    Почему калибровка съезжает, я не знаю. Вполне может и от питания зависеть, у меня в компе стоят СД-ДВДприводы, но они нужны редко, поэтому отключены в целях экономии мощности питания компа, и то случается мобильник(GPRS-модем) отключается сам по себе, но калибровка у меня не съезжает.

    Блин, вспомнил... было как то боролся с центровкой в АВ2(в те времена когда МаРСы в него ставил), вот тогда замечал нечто подобное в Ил-2.
    ...при перезагрузке вылета(в простом редакторе), если РУС в этот момент был не в центре(я пружину загрузочную снимал), то типа джой перекалибровывался, и леталось так до следующего вылета-перезагрузки.
    Вот и думай тут, питание или ещё в чём причина. ))

  4. #1354
    Зашедший Аватар для ironman
    Регистрация
    03.06.2005
    Адрес
    Господин Великий Новгород
    Возраст
    60
    Сообщений
    434

    Re: USB контроллер джоистика

    Вот и я в недоумении , почему так .Хотя 350ватт должно хватать, оно , конечно, БП тож разные , производители в смысле, мой , увы, не из "крутых".Причём отваливается до20едениц по краям ( по кугаровскому аналайзеру) Это на Холлах 496а , по X,Y , а на резюках стоит.

  5. #1355
    Забанен Аватар для catfish
    Регистрация
    22.11.2001
    Адрес
    Moscow
    Возраст
    43
    Сообщений
    1,250

    Re: USB контроллер джоистика

    Цитата Сообщение от fred kaa Посмотреть сообщение
    По идее не должно сгореть(если сгорит, у меня есть ещё два контроллера)), то есть я говорил о примерных напряжениях, с более точными цифрами получается такая картинка:
    На Mjopy16 и датчиках ss495A у меня выходит такая картина, не дотягивает отклик до конечных значений буквально по 4 единицы градаций контроллера.
    5 вольт делим на 1024, получаем 0,0048828125вольта на градацию, умножаем на 4, получаем 0,01953125. То есть, по моим рассуждениям нужно подать на холл 5,02 вольта для получения полного отклика, при этом на вход контроллера доберётся положенные 5 вольт(почему должен сгореть АЦП? ).
    ...отклика и так хватает, но хочется достичь идеала )) ...знаний только у меня не хватает (
    При превышении входного напряжения АЦП над опорным, микруху постигнет внезапная смерть

  6. #1356
    ED Team Аватар для USSR_Rik
    Регистрация
    16.08.2003
    Адрес
    Belarus, Minsk
    Сообщений
    2,450

    Re: USB контроллер джоистика

    Вот кусочек даташита на мегу16, снятый из pdf - там про входные аналоговые напряжения и опору.

    Вообще давно (когда деревья были маленькие) в КМОП-логике был "тиристорный эффект". При выходе входного напряжения вверх за питание паразитные входные тиристорные структуры переключались в режим проводимости и микросхема начинала жрать большой ток, быстро сгорала. Боролись с этим, вроде перестроили структуры, вроде победили - но с тех пор я таких вещей опасаюсь. По-моему, более правильный путь - работа с диапазоном датчика, хоть это и более муторно.

    По блокам питания. Мощность, конечно, важна - но в нашем случае важнее стабильность напряжения. А линия +5 вольт в компе нагружена прилично, к тому же - никого из производителей не заботит то, что от нее будут питаться сугубо аналоговые цепи с высокими требованиями по стабильности.

    По уму - тут надо бы вообще разделить питание. Для цифровой части сгодятся и юсб-шные 5 вольт, а для аналоговой взять (хоть из компа) +12 да хорошим стабилизатором сделать все что надо. Везде плюсы, кроме некоторого усложнения схемы и необходимости вытаскивания этих самых +12 вольт. Ну или нормальный сетевой блок.

    Кстати, у Хоровица-Хилла, если мне не изменяет ни с кем память, есть небольшая главка про расчет бюджета погрешностей схемы. Я думаю, что если к делу подходить серьезно и замахиваться на 1024 отсчета - имеет смысл посчитать да подумать.
    Миниатюры Миниатюры Нажмите на изображение для увеличения. 

Название:	ATmega16.jpg 
Просмотров:	275 
Размер:	56.1 Кб 
ID:	64474  
    ...чего уж тигру лишняя полосочка... (© - не помню)

  7. #1357
    Механик
    Регистрация
    28.02.2006
    Адрес
    Хмельницкий, Украина
    Возраст
    57
    Сообщений
    302

    Re: USB контроллер джоистика

    Цитата Сообщение от fred kaa Посмотреть сообщение
    YuretsKm, я просто подумал как проще, типа если провалить питание на 2-5% то ничего страшного произойти не должно(у сайтеков на Евах и х45 вобще ни разу не видел положенных 3.3 вольта, всегда меньше, перелопатил более десятка джоев), на холл дать то что с USB приходит...что выйдет не знаю.
    ...эх, если б я знал что делает "нога" AREF, да и остальные ))
    Так это и есть проще. Нога AREF (на меге8 - 21 нога, на меге16 - 32 нога) - это то чем задается 100% отсчета и изменение напряжения на ней это штатная операция, уменьшать можно ЕМНИП аж до 2В. Если регулировать питание всего контроллера нужно помнить не только про напряжение но и про ток, а AREF ток не важен.

  8. #1358
    Курсант
    Регистрация
    06.02.2005
    Адрес
    Северодвинск
    Возраст
    58
    Сообщений
    426

    Re: USB контроллер джоистика

    YuretsKm, спасиб!!!! Появился повод крепко подумать не только в сторону Атмегов. ))

  9. #1359

    Re: USB контроллер джоистика

    catfish
    ничего ее не постигнет - если не будешь сильно максимальное напряжение питания превышать
    fred kaa
    если опорное напряжение сделать слишком малым - возрастут шумы - 2.5V наверно оптимум

  10. #1360
    Механник Аватар для J0kER
    Регистрация
    16.02.2005
    Адрес
    Красноярск, Россия
    Сообщений
    425

    Re: USB контроллер джоистика

    Господа, подскажите, а если мне приспичит поменять кварц на керамический резонатор в MJoy8?
    Например, ZTT 12MHz, точность 0.3, 30 пФ встроеные конденсаторы
    http://www.chipdip.ru/library/DOC000051135.pdf
    какие фьюзы надоть поправить..

    Спасибо..

  11. #1361
    Механик
    Регистрация
    28.02.2006
    Адрес
    Хмельницкий, Украина
    Возраст
    57
    Сообщений
    302

    Re: USB контроллер джоистика

    Цитата Сообщение от fred kaa Посмотреть сообщение
    YuretsKm, спасиб!!!! Появился повод крепко подумать не только в сторону Атмегов. ))
    А что так? Чем АТмеги стали так немилы?

  12. #1362
    Пилот Аватар для Gelo
    Регистрация
    13.03.2006
    Адрес
    Вятка
    Возраст
    51
    Сообщений
    818

    Re: USB контроллер джоистика

    Может ли кто помочь разобраться в программе контроллера. Суть вот в чем: в прошивке v1.1 одна из осей называется Диск и Ил ее не видит, в v1.2 это изменили, но автокалибровке мне не нужна, точнее у меня с ней проблемы. Может ли кто подсказать как в v1.1 изменить название оси? Очень надо :sad:

  13. #1363
    Инструктор
    Регистрация
    26.02.2005
    Адрес
    Саратов
    Возраст
    55
    Сообщений
    1,355

    Re: USB контроллер джоистика

    Цитата Сообщение от Gelo Посмотреть сообщение
    Может ли кто помочь разобраться в программе контроллера. Суть вот в чем: в прошивке v1.1 одна из осей называется Диск и Ил ее не видит, в v1.2 это изменили, но автокалибровке мне не нужна, точнее у меня с ней проблемы. Может ли кто подсказать как в v1.1 изменить название оси? Очень надо :sad:
    Ткните пржалуйста носом в прошивку 1.2 Не нашел

  14. #1364
    Пилот Аватар для Gelo
    Регистрация
    13.03.2006
    Адрес
    Вятка
    Возраст
    51
    Сообщений
    818

    Re: USB контроллер джоистика

    Цитата Сообщение от VadNik Посмотреть сообщение
    Ткните пржалуйста носом в прошивку 1.2 Не нашел
    http://www.mindaugas.com/projects/MJoy/Versions.php

    Забыл :sad: , речь о MJoy8

  15. #1365
    Курсант
    Регистрация
    06.02.2005
    Адрес
    Северодвинск
    Возраст
    58
    Сообщений
    426

    Re: USB контроллер джоистика

    Цитата Сообщение от YuretsKm Посмотреть сообщение
    А что так? Чем АТмеги стали так немилы?
    Не, к АТмегам у меня нормально ))
    Просто совпало к одному времени, ответ на вопрос по ноге AREF, и моё ковыряние джоя Ева(безпроводная, там питания одна батарейка 1,5 вольта, соображаю можно ли холл там заставить работать)... и подумалось про напряжение в сайтеках на резисторах в 3,3 вольта.
    Поэтому такая общая мысль и возникла )) ...правда, на практике это опробовать не получается.

  16. #1366
    Механик
    Регистрация
    28.02.2006
    Адрес
    Хмельницкий, Украина
    Возраст
    57
    Сообщений
    302

    Re: USB контроллер джоистика

    Цитата Сообщение от fred kaa Посмотреть сообщение
    Не, к АТмегам у меня нормально ))
    Просто совпало к одному времени, ответ на вопрос по ноге AREF, и моё ковыряние джоя Ева(безпроводная, там питания одна батарейка 1,5 вольта, соображаю можно ли холл там заставить работать)... и подумалось про напряжение в сайтеках на резисторах в 3,3 вольта.
    Поэтому такая общая мысль и возникла )) ...правда, на практике это опробовать не получается.
    Вот здесь поковыряйся http://kosmodrom.com.ua , в подразделе "Продукция" описалова на разные датчики есть, может чего интересного найдешь.

  17. #1367

    Re: USB контроллер джоистика

    Народ... Помогите подобрать корзину для покупки деталющек для Mjoy16.
    Т.к. от элетротехники знаком на низком уровне, то ниче собсна не шарю в резисторах и прочих заморочках...
    Так что приведу список что насобирал и в чем не разобрался... Помогите пожалуйста...
    1. ATmega16-16PU(PI) PDIP40 - такой вроде да???
    2. К 50-35 10 мкф х 16 в 105 гр.
    3. B37940-K5150-J60,0805NPO50v 5% 15pF, 2 штуки
    4. B37872-K5104-K60,1206X7R50v10%0.1uF, 3 штуки
    5. B82494-A1103-K ,SMD1008 10% 10uH, за этим придется ехать отдельно
    6. 1N4733A,стабилитрон 5.1В,1Вт, 2 штуки
    7. Кв.рез. 12.000 МГц имп. HC-49SM
    Дальше нужны резисторы...
    Только насколько ватт и какие???
    SQP резистор 5 вт 2.2 ком
    или
    SQP резистор 10 вт 2.2 ком
    2.2 килоома - 1 штука
    4.7 килоома - 1 штука
    330 ом - 4 штуки
    82 ома - 2 штуки
    И этова... Для матрицы нужны диоды... А какие???

  18. #1368
    Пилот Аватар для Gelo
    Регистрация
    13.03.2006
    Адрес
    Вятка
    Возраст
    51
    Сообщений
    818

    Re: USB контроллер джоистика

    Стабилитроны надо на 3.3 вольта
    Цитата Сообщение от JimmyBV Посмотреть сообщение
    Дальше нужны резисторы...
    Только насколько ватт и какие???
    резисторы на 0,125 или 0,25 Вт. 5-ти ватные размером будут с весь контроллер
    Цитата Сообщение от JimmyBV Посмотреть сообщение
    И этова... Для матрицы нужны диоды... А какие???
    http://www.chip-dip.ru/product0/49250.aspx
    или
    http://www.chip-dip.ru/product0/56882.aspx

  19. #1369

    Re: USB контроллер джоистика

    А микроконтроллер то именно такой нужен???

  20. #1370
    =FB=
    Регистрация
    18.01.2005
    Адрес
    Russia
    Возраст
    47
    Сообщений
    513

    Re: USB контроллер джоистика

    Цитата Сообщение от Gelo Посмотреть сообщение
    Стабилитроны надо на 3.3 вольта
    0,5 ватные подойдут или надо больше?
    http://s019.radikal.ru/i601/1212/67/9b9828fdf8dc.jpg

  21. #1371
    Механник Аватар для J0kER
    Регистрация
    16.02.2005
    Адрес
    Красноярск, Россия
    Сообщений
    425

    Re: USB контроллер джоистика

    Цитата Сообщение от Wincel Посмотреть сообщение
    0,5 ватные подойдут или надо больше?
    Пойдут.
    Еще рекомендую поставить параллельно стабилитронам конденсаторы 200-400 пФ, чтобы выполнить требования п.7.1.1.2 стандарта USB.
    Почему-то на этом форуме имим прнебрегают.. Потом появляются вопорсы "я все правильно спаял, 3 раза проверил монтаж, а у меня все равно "Устройство USB не опознано".

  22. #1372

    Re: USB контроллер джоистика

    J0kER
    у керамических резонаторов точность на 2 порядка ниже да и температурная стабильность хуже
    и неизвестно как комп к нестабильности частоты отнесется (от чипсета зависит)
    да и емкость на ножках больше рекомендованной (нужно 15-22pF)
    если хочешь 100% попадание то лучше взять кварц

    по питанию с USB желательно - кондесатор - ферритовая бусина - кондесатор - стабилитрон - кондесатор (кондесаторы - керамика)
    ферритовую бусину можно заменить индуктивностью (можно и самому намотать)

  23. #1373
    Механник Аватар для J0kER
    Регистрация
    16.02.2005
    Адрес
    Красноярск, Россия
    Сообщений
    425

    Re: USB контроллер джоистика

    Цитата Сообщение от mrFox Посмотреть сообщение
    J0kER
    у керамических резонаторов точность на 2 порядка ниже да и температурная стабильность хуже
    и неизвестно как комп к нестабильности частоты отнесется (от чипсета зависит)
    да и емкость на ножках больше рекомендованной (нужно 15-22pF)
    если хочешь 100% попадание то лучше взять кварц
    Видимо, придется оставить кварцы. не хотить заводится с керамическим резонатором.
    керамику оставим для самостоятельных, не сопрягаемых с USB устройств..
    А по поводу кондеров - видимо, неправильно понял. Рекомендую шунтировать D+ и D- емкостями 200-400пикух

  24. #1374
    =FB=
    Регистрация
    18.01.2005
    Адрес
    Russia
    Возраст
    47
    Сообщений
    513

    Re: USB контроллер джоистика

    Отцы, подскажите плиз. Собрал 2 контроллёра на 16 атмеге,по разводке фреда каа, прошил, всё намано, джой виндой распознался. Начинаю проверять, припоял один переменный резюк, пробую его крутить, а в окошке настройки все оси джоя вертятся, а не одна((( как должно быть, при этом от самого резюка начинает гарью попахивать, проверил плату на наличие соплей и всякого брака-ничего, причём такая трабла на обеих спаянных мной платах(((. Что это могёт быть?
    http://s019.radikal.ru/i601/1212/67/9b9828fdf8dc.jpg

  25. #1375
    ED Team Аватар для USSR_Rik
    Регистрация
    16.08.2003
    Адрес
    Belarus, Minsk
    Сообщений
    2,450

    Re: USB контроллер джоистика

    при этом от самого резюка начинает гарью попахивать,
    Почти наверняка попутан провод питания (или земли) с сигнальным. В этом случае в одном из крайних положений резистора-датчика получается короткое замыкание по питанию.

    По поводу "в окошке настройки все оси джоя вертятся" - висящие в воздухе оси (которые ты еще не подключил) просто заземли.
    ...чего уж тигру лишняя полосочка... (© - не помню)

Страница 55 из 112 ПерваяПервая ... 54551525354555657585965105 ... КрайняяКрайняя

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•